Jaguar turns 75

2010 marks the 75th anniversary of the first use of the Jaguar name. To celebrate this anniversary, Jaguar is planning special appearances at the Goodwood Festival of Speed and Revival, Pebble Beach Concours d’Elegance, and the Mille Miglia among other top events.
Mike O’Driscoll, managing director of Jaguar Cars said
In 2010, we celebrate our past, and 75 years of designing and building cars that celebrate the art of automobile making. We’re also celebrating the promise of the future, and the introduction of the all-new XJ sedan.
